Considering that your roof is continually exposed to the weather, this means your roof is will degrade with time. The rate at which it deteriorates will be dependent on a range of factors. These include; the quality of the original components used and the workmanship, the amount of abuse it will have to take from the elements, how well the roof is preserved and the style of the roof. Most roofing contractors will quote around 20 years for a well-built and properly maintained roof, but obviously that can never be promised due to the above factors. Our suggestion is to always keep your roof well maintained and get regular roof inspections to be sure it lasts as long as possible.
You shouldn’t ever pressure wash your roof, as you take the risk of eliminating any covering materials that have been included to give cover from the weather. Additionally, you should keep away from chlorine-based bleach cleaning products as they may also lower the life-span of your roof. When you talk to your roof cleaning expert, tell them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to clean your roof. This will remove the unappealing algae and discoloration without ruining the tile or shingles.

A regular roof assessment program can help your organisation extend roof life expectancy and lower the requirement for emergency repairs. Routinely checking and preserving roof surfaces, drains pipes and downspouts is critical to an overall building preventive maintenance program. Here are some steps to develop a roofing system inspection program that can help improve the performance of your roofing.
In the spring, check for potential damage that may have happened from serious winter season weather condition and determine needed repair work. In the fall, look for any preventive action needed prior to winter season gets here. Begin the roofing system examination inside the building. Inspect all interior walls and ceilings for indications of water stains, fractures and settling of structure walls.
Keep drain systems clear and practical. Get rid of/ make repair work to areas with standing water or “ponding.” Train maintenance workers on roofing system building and construction and related ongoing maintenance requirements. Restrict roofing access to authorized personnel only. Limitation penetrations of the roof system. Screen sloped roofs with overhangs for the creation of ice dams and add insulation to the attic as necessary.

Checking roof surfaces and maintaining the integrity of roofing surface areas and drains can assist prolong the life of the roof and pay dividends in roof efficiency. The most typical warning indications of a leak are: Musty odors in certain rooms. Water discolorations on your ceiling. Areas on your exterior walls. Bulging patches on your interior walls. If you discover any of these signs, your next step is to find the leakage and hire a professional to restore the hole in your roofing.
An essential piece of suggestions when it concerns preserving a shingle roofing system is to clean it. At some point, your roofing system will start to look dirty, with long, dark streaks streaming from peak to eave. This is algae growing on your home. Algae will not trigger any instant damage, but if you leave it long enough it can gradually rot your shingles.
The bleach will eliminate the algae fairly rapidly, however you’ll likewise wish to set up copper strips simply underneath your roof’s peak. When it rains, the copper particles will stream down your roof, killing any algae repairing for a return. No roofing upkeep checklist would be total without this tip. Though it’s an unclean task, cleaning out your rain gutters is an important part of keeping your roof.

Most specialists suggest cleaning them out two times a year, when in late spring and once again in early fall, as part of a regular fall house maintenance checklist. Tree branches can be a problem for a couple of reasons, the most obvious being the risk of them falling on your roof throughout extreme weather condition.
This will help in reducing storm damage, while also preventing leaves from piling on top of your shingles, soaking up wetness and ultimately decaying your roof. While running through your roof upkeep checklist, make sure you take a look at your chimney for cracks or missing mortar. Structural damage of any size can trigger bricks to start falling out, which can damage your roof, not to mention trigger your chimney to collapse.
A sloping or leaning chimney can be triggered by concerns with your house’s foundation also. If you discover your chimney has actually moved, call a specialist to have it repaired immediately and examine the rest of your home for indications of structure problems.
